SHOWTIME podcasts feature in-depth conversations with the people shaping Melbourne’s vibrant theatre scene. Offering an insider’s guide to the world of live performance, the series spotlights a ‘who’s who’ of both established and emerging talents. From the latest in Musical Theatre, Plays, and Cabaret, to behind-the-scenes stories and upcoming productions, SHOWTIME with Andrew G captures the essence of what makes Melbourne’s stages come alive, celebrating the artists and shows that define the city’s rich theatrical culture.

The Passion Project Helping Thousands Find Their Next Stage Role
Dawn Riddale, once a musical theatre performer, is the founder of Melbourne Theatre News and Just Auditions, two platforms that have transformed how Melbourne’s community theatre scene connects. Before they existed, show and audition details were scattered and hard to find. Dawn and her fiancé Craig created centralised hubs where performers, theatre companies and audiences could easily share and access information.
Just Auditions Victoria now has over 13,000 followers and has expanded to other states with varying success, depending on local participation. Dawn stresses that active community involvement is essential to keep the platforms vibrant and up to date.
She also values Melbourne’s unique theatre culture, including traditions like sharing a “sherry” before a show, which she believes helps strengthen connections.
Marketing remains a challenge for many community and independent theatre groups, and Dawn advocates for clear, timely promotion that includes all the essential details.
Run entirely by volunteers and free to use, these platforms are a labour of love. Dawn hopes more people will help manage them so they can continue supporting and connecting theatre lovers for years to come.

DAWN RIDSDALEDawn Ridsdale is an accomplished performer, director, and theatre maker with over 20 years in Australian community theatre. She has appeared in productions including The Wiz, Don’t Dress for Dinner, David Copperfield, Cosi, A Murder is Announced, It’s My Party (And I’ll Die If I Want To), The Odd Couple (female version), and Waiting for God. Her directing and production credits include Don’t Dress for Dinner, Dimboola, and That Scottish Play. Dawn has also worked as a stage manager and production coordinator, bringing a wealth of skills to every project. Her passion, versatility, and dedication make her a valued member of the theatre community.
